"Boasting a large corner plot in the PREMIER Leeds Road area of Selby, this excellent three bedroom detached bungalow is available with no upward chain. The property benefits from gas central heating, UPVC double glazed windows, spacious accommodation, single garage, excellent mature gardens and viewing is highly recommended. Accommodation briefly comprises entrance lobby/utility, spacious kitchen, lounge, hallway, dining room, en suite to master bedroom with walk-in wardrobe and family bathroom.
